访问如何设置Redis远程IP访问权限(redis远程ip)

2023-05-08 07:51:45 访问 如何设置 访问权限

随着Redis近年来逐渐受到开发者和企业的青睐,如何在安全的前提下正确配置Redis远程IP访问管理权限,变得越发重要。本文从防火墙的配置入手,介绍如何设置Redis远程IP访问权限。

我们需要进行Redis服务端的配置。当Redis Server和Client启动之后,在redis的配置文件中调整bindIP以指定远程服务端的IP地址和端口号:

“`conf

bind {127.0.0.1}

port 6379


设置Redis远程访问权限,确保只允许指定IP访问Redis集群,以及所拥有对相应数据库或命令的访问权限。具体技术方案如下:

1. 设置Redis配置文件中的requirepass参数,为Redis服务端设置访问密码,以便进行安全访问;

```conf
requirepass password

2. 在Redis中设置允许授权的IP列表,这些IP允许访问redis服务端;

127.0.0.1,192.168.1.100

3. 使用AOF技术对授予的IP表进行持久化处理,将其存入Redis的AOF文件中;

appendonly-allowlisted-ips

可以开放部分Redis端口,并在防火墙层面进行IP白名单的设置,以进一步访问安全,具体代码如下:

“`bash

sudo iptables -I INPUT -p tcp –dport 6379 -s 141.225.19.186 -j ACCEPT


设置Redis远程IP访问权限既要从系统层面设置,也要从应用层面设置,以确保Redis安全性。如果在设置Redis远程IP访问权限时遇到困难,可以通过社区和在线的技术支持,进行问题解决。

相关文章